Experiments on Large Single Crystals of the Superconducting Oxides YBa(2)Cu(3)O(7), La(2-x)BA(x)CuO(4), and BiCa-Sr-Cu-O

Abstract

The growth and characterization of single crystals of the high temperature superconductors was investigated. High temperature, high pressure annealing of crystals of YBCO was carried out and found to be ineffective in further raising the Tc of the crystals beyond 93 K. Torque magnetometry measurements on YBCO crystals showed that the coherence length anisotropy is 5. 5, independent of temperature in the range 80 to 90 K. The growth of the '40 K' system based on LaCuO doped with Ba, was attempted. Large crystals were obtained, but the Ba content (x approx. 0.5) was too high to sustain high temperature superconductivity.
